  • With The Implementation Of NLTP Act 1989, Nagaland Being A Dry State, It Was Reported That Lake View Colony Youths Apprehended 5 Persons With Illicit Liquor. Along With The Culprits, 3 Cases Of Rum & 1 Case Of Whisky Worth ₹12,000 Was Recovered By The Youths Of Lake View Colony.
